After the fun we had at Rangley Park, Day 5 had a lot to live up to. Although the day would be short, it didn’t disappoint. We started off on beautiful drive through the hills.

After a little bit of road miles, we quickly realized we were at the trail head of one of Colorado’s gnarliest trails, 21 Road.

We had a quick lunch break during which Mel and crew had the guests and sponsors team up to see who could change a tire the fastest.

After the games and lunch, we were off!

Moving slowly, Mel’s crew successfully help navigate everyone through the twisted, bumpy trail.

Some rocks we were able to barely make over.

While other parts we were barely able to make under.

Then we came up on this part of the trail.

This was a large cut-out of the hill side that provided a cool damp area with tricky mud holes and rocks. Lots of messy fun!

Extra lights were definitely needed here. Thanks Rigid!

Go towards the light!

Since this was such a fun spot, we all lined up for another group selfie.

After 21 Road, we headed back to the hotel for repairs and rest. Today was another exhausting day. We were told Day 6 involved some road miles but it would be worth it. So far, every road mile was worth it and we couldn’t wait to see what was next!
